Claude Code 作为一款强大的 AI 编程代理工具,其学习曲线可以通过结构化的资源进行有效平缓。luongnv89/claude-howto 仓库正是为此设计,它提供了一个视觉化、示例驱动的渐进式教程 。以下是如何利用该仓库快速上手的详细路径。

一、核心学习模块与快速启动

该仓库的核心是 10个结构化学习模块,它们从基础概念一直覆盖到高级的 Agent 编排 。要快速上手,建议遵循以下核心模块顺序:

学习阶段 核心模块 关键学习目标 预计耗时
基础认知 模块1-3:环境与核心概念 完成安装、理解三种模式(聊天、编辑、计划)、掌握基础文件操作 30分钟
效率提升 模块4-6:命令与上下文 熟练使用斜杠命令、管理项目记忆、配置 CLAUDE.md 1小时
能力扩展 模块7-9:技能与自动化 安装使用 Skills、理解 Hooks 自动化、初步接触 MCP 1.5小时
高级协作 模块10:多代理协作 理解并实践 Subagents 的创建与协同工作 1小时

启动学习的最快方式是直接使用其提供的 Copy-Paste Templates(复制粘贴模板)。这些模板是预配置好的代码片段或配置文件,可以让你跳过繁琐的初始设置,直接体验功能 。例如,你可以快速创建一个基础的 CLAUDE.md 文件来定义项目规范。

二、实战演练:从“Hello World”到多文件项目

理论学习必须结合实践。该指南强调通过动手来巩固知识 。

  1. 环境初始化:按照指南完成 Claude Code 的安装和身份验证后,在你的项目目录中运行 /init 命令。这会启动一个交互式会话,Claude Code 会自动分析你的项目结构 。
  2. 首个任务 - 创建 Web 服务器:尝试一个简单的目标,例如“创建一个使用 Express 的 'Hello World' API 服务器”。你可以直接使用仓库中提供的 Node.js/Express 模板开始。
    // 参考 [luongnv89/claude-howto] 模板,快速生成一个 Express 应用骨架
    const express = require('express');
    const app = express();
    const port = 3000;
    
    app.get('/', (req, res) => {
      res.send('Hello World from Claude Code!');
    });
    
    app.listen(port, () => {
      console.log(`App running on http://localhost:${port}`);
    });
    
    在此过程中,你会自然学到如何使用 Claude Code 编写代码、运行测试和修复错误。
  3. 进阶任务 - 重构与增强:在基础项目上,提出更复杂的需求,如“添加一个 /health 端点并返回 JSON 状态”或“将配置抽离到 .env 文件中”。这时,你会运用到更高级的命令,如使用 /plan 模式让 Claude Code 先制定实施步骤 。

三、利用内置工具巩固学习

该仓库设计了配套工具来确保学习效果:

  • 自测测验与课后测试:每个模块都配有 /self-assessment/lesson-quiz。强烈建议完成这些测试,它们能有效帮你查漏补缺,确认是否真正掌握了当前模块的知识点 。
  • 离线电子书生成:对于需要深度学习或网络不便的情况,该仓库支持生成 EPUB 格式的离线电子书。你可以将整个教程下载到本地,随时随地翻阅,这对于构建系统性的知识体系非常有帮助 。

四、集成到日常开发工作流

快速上手的最终目的是将 Claude Code 转化为生产力。你可以从以下几个具体场景开始实践:

  • 代码审查助手:在提交代码前,让 Claude Code 执行 /review 命令。它可以基于你定义的规则(在 CLAUDE.md 中)自动检查代码风格、潜在 bug 和安全漏洞,实现智能代码审查 。
  • 自动化脚本编写:描述一个重复性任务,如“编写一个 Python 脚本,遍历目录,将所有 .txt 文件中的特定关键词替换掉”。Claude Code 能快速生成可运行的脚本,并解释其逻辑。
  • 文档生成与更新:利用其强大的上下文理解能力,你可以指令它“根据 src/ 目录下的最新代码,更新项目的 README.md 文档”。它能保持文档与代码同步 。

通过遵循 luongnv89/claude-howto 提供的这条从模板实践模块化学习,再到工作流集成的路径,你可以在一个周末内系统地掌握 Claude Code 的核心能力,从而将 AI 编程代理从一个“会打字的助手”转变为一个“会指挥的协作者”,显著提升开发效率与代码质量 。


参考来源

Logo

openEuler 是由开放原子开源基金会孵化的全场景开源操作系统项目,面向数字基础设施四大核心场景(服务器、云计算、边缘计算、嵌入式),全面支持 ARM、x86、RISC-V、loongArch、PowerPC、SW-64 等多样性计算架构

更多推荐